Tissus urbains

Jan 23–July 10, 2021
Curated: Marc Bembekoff
La Galerie, centre d’art contemporain, Noisy-le-Sec

The exhibition presents drawings, maquettes, and sculptural works examining urban spaces through architectural observation and research. Metro stations, squares, and agoras, including Gare du Nord, Alexanderplatz, Kotti, and Les Halles, are reworked to consider social interaction and the organisation of public space.

Several works were developed during a residency in Noisy-le-Sec and focus on the area surrounding La Galerie, particularly the Esplanade Simone-Veil. A large-scale maquette of the neighbouring tower blocks reproduces the façades of the 1970s buildings, while their reverse sides incorporate patterns derived from local visual cultures. An oversized wall map of Noisy-le-Sec offers an alternative reading of the municipality, countering standardised urban representations.
